Carlyle Isn't in a Rush for Permanent Capital

Carlyle Isn't in a Rush for Permanent Capital

(Bloomberg) -- At a time when KKR & Co. and Blackstone Group LP are finding ways to lock up client money for longer, Carlyle Group LP's David Rubenstein doesn't seem to be in a rush to do the same.

The private equity behemoth, where co-founder Rubenstein is the chief fundraiser, can revisit investor wallets with relative ease, he said Tuesday.

“We have a pretty good ability to get capital when we need it and we really haven't struggled to raise capital in any recent time,” Rubenstein told investors and analysts while discussing third-quarter results. “We are always looking at different permutations of how you can raise capital, but I'd say right now the model that we have is one that we're reasonably comfortable with.”

Long-dated and permanent-capital vehicles can reduce the frequency of fundraising, permit longer investments in assets worth holding on to, and generate more predictable fees. Carlyle does have a longer-life private equity fund, championed by co-CEO designate Kewsong Lee. The pool is doing “quite well” and will likely have a larger successor fund, Rubenstein said.

But the appeal to Carlyle doesn't seem to be as great as, say, at KKR, where a new pair of long-term investor agreements was the centerpiece of the firm's earnings call last week. The partnerships secured $7 billion in fresh capital.

“When you have a reputation as we do, and as other peers that we compete with do, and you go out and raise a successor buyout fund, while you have to go out and raise it, it's -- I won't call it permanent capital -- but it's very likely you can raise these funds for quite some time into the future,” said Rubenstein.
